Which is best MACD settings for 1 min chart?

 

Hi,

I am working with MACD+stoch +Bollinger band settings.

MACD (default)

Bollinger band (20,2)

Stoch (14,3,3)

EMA 10

and a MACD cross over alert indicator.

Now,the problem is, sometimes it works great,but sometimes not specially in Asian session on EUR/USD.

I get lot of whipsaw,To avoid it???

Please help.your suggestion is valuable for me.

Asian sessions most of the time require different trading systems, or at least changing of the indicator settings. Also you may consider to not trade during that session.

Speaking of MACD for 1 min EURUSD... Try MACD (20, 50, 26).

It'll filter the weak signals, but at the cost of a later entry.

Exits can be done in 2 steps:

1) 1/2 with regular faster MACD (12, 26, 9)

2) 1/2 with the slower MACD (20, 50, 26).

It is better to leave the default indicators settings and change the time frames to find meaningful signals rather than adapt the indicators settings to the price action. That way the price action will undergo more filtering resulting in an higher information level contained in the signal.
